Files
Odin/core/rexcode/arm64/tablegen
Brendan Punsky a1e359b64a rexcode/arm64: NEON permute, compare-zero, SXTL/UXTL encode forms
ZIP1/2, UZP1/2, TRN1/2 (three-same permute); CMLE/CMLT and FP
FCMLE/FCMLT (compare against zero, with the literal #0 / #0.0 operand);
SXTL/SXTL2/UXTL/UXTL2 (= SSHLL/USHLL #0, plain 2-register widen, shift
implicit in the static bits). All reuse the VD/VN/VM register slots, so
no encoder change. specgen gains an emit_cmp0 shape plus permute and
widen families. All forms byte-exact vs llvm-mc; 461 tests green.
2026-06-17 23:03:53 -04:00
..